Alberto G. Badua died at his home in Morgan Hill Thursday, March 7, 2005.
A native of the Philippines, he was 84.
Mr. Badua moved to Morgan Hill in 1984 from the Philippines to live with his daughter Rebecca and son-in-law, Romie Cortez.
He worked as a Laundromat janitor and a groundskeeper at the Village Avante for many years. Before moving to the United States he was a Barangay Chairman (captain) for more than 14 years in Esperanza, Umingan, Pangasinan, P.I. He was also a Filipino Army World War II Veteran honored by the United States Government.
He is husband of the late Josefina Badua; and father of Rebecca Cortez, Chita Dela Cruz, Jenette Badua and the late Ronie, Virgie, Virgilio and Danny Badua.
He was preceded in death by his parents and all of his brother and sisters.
